Hone

WILLIAM, an English antiquary; born in 1780. He began life in a law office and became imbued with freethinking opinions. In 1817 he was prosecuted by the English Government for the publication of alleged irreverent parodies and lampoons, when he defended himself and was acquitted. He gradually abandoned freethought for religious and antiquarian studies. His chief publications are the "Every-day Book" (1826); "Table-talk" (1827- 1828); and "Year Book" (1829). He died in 1842.
